Semantic search enhances AI agent discovery beyond traditional methods

Traditional service discovery methods struggle with the dynamic and descriptive nature of AI agents. Semantic search offers a solution by indexing server capabilities as dense vectors, allowing discovery through natural language queries rather than rigid identifiers. This approach is particularly useful for finding AI agents with specific, nuanced functionalities that might not be captured by conventional tags or DNS records. AI
